NEWS FROM WOCN Wound, Ostomy and Continence (WOC) nursing is one of the newest specialties recognized by the American Nurses Association (ANA). The Wound Ostomy & Continence Nursing Society (WOCN) was recently notified of the ANA's decision. WOCN has The WOC Nursing Scope and Standards which can be purchased at the WOCN bookstore. |

Barbara Bates Jensen was awarded The Research Award at WOCN for her article titled "Subepidermal Moisture is Associated with Early Pressure Ulcer Damage in Nursing Home Residents with Dark Skin Tone", published in the Journal of Wound, Ostomy and Continence Nursing.
